Home ASP.NET 12 Best + Free ASP.NET Courses

12 Best + Free ASP.NET Courses [ASP.NET Core MVC]

204
0

ASP.NET core is the latest web framework introduced by Microsoft. It is engineered to be not only fast but easy and to work across platforms efficiently. It is an open-source version of ASP.NET that can run on macOS, Linux, and Windows as well. It was first released in the year 2016 and is considered to be the re-design of earlier Windows-only versions of ASP.NET.

Benefits of Using ASP.NET Core

Using ASP.NET comes with multiple benefits including;

  • It offers a unified story for building web UI and APIs.
  • It offers the ability to develop and run on not only Linux but Windows and macOS.
  • Similarly, it is architected for testability.
  • The Blazor lets you use C# in the browser alongside JavaScript.
  • The razor pages enable coding page-focused scenarios to be easier and more productive.

To learn more about ASP.NET Core and its usability, our experts at takethiscourse.net has compiled a list of Best + Free ASP.NET Courses [ASP.NET Core MVC]. With the help of this list, you can get access to the best and free ASP.NET Core courses and classes and start learning all about it today. So, let us take a look at the ASP.NET courses and classes available in this list.

# Course Name University/Organization Ratings Duration
1. ASP.NET Core Fundamentals Course Pluralsight ★★★★★4.5 (837 Reviews) 06 Hours
2. Learning ASP.NET Core MVC LinkedIn Learning ★★★★★4.5 (662 Reviews) 03 Hours
3. Complete Guide to Building an App with .Net Core and React Udemy ★★★★★4.6 (5,447 Reviews) 32.5 Hours
4. Build a Wishlist Application with ASP.NET Core Pluralsight ★★★★4.0 (650 Reviews) 2.5 Hours
5. Complete guide to ASP.NET Core MVC (.NET 6) Udemy ★★★★4.4 (7,584 Reviews) 14.5 Hours
6. Complete SignalR On ASP.NET Core tutorials point 01 Hour
7. ASP.NET Core: Security LinkedIn Learning ★★★★★4.6 (71 Reviews) 1.5 Hours
8. Build an app with ASPNET Core and Angular from scratch Udemy ★★★★★4.6 (19,302 Reviews) 30 Hours
9. Creating GraphQL APIs With ASP.Net Core For Beginners tutorials point 03 Hours
10. ASP.NET Core: Middleware LinkedIn Learning ★★★★★4.7 (72 Reviews) 34 Min
11. Create a StarChart Web API using ASP.NET Core Pluralsight ★★★★★4.5 (504 Reviews) 03 Hours
12. Deploying ASP.NET Core Applications LinkedIn Learning ★★★★★4.6 (55 Reviews) 01 Hour
In order to help our readers in taking a knowledgeable learning decision, TakeThisCourse.net has introduced a metric to measure the effectiveness of an online course. Learn more about how we measure an online course effectiveness.

Best + Free ASP.NET Courses

save

ASP.NET Core Fundamentals Course

      • Scott Allen via Pluralsight
      • 05h 44m of effort required!
      • ★★★★★ (837 Ratings)

ASP.NET Core Fundamentals

Online Course Effectiveness Score 
Content Engagement Practice Career Benefit
Good
★★★★☆
Good
★★★★☆
Fair
★★★☆☆
Fair
★★★☆☆

In this course, the instructor will explain the fundamentals of ASP.NET core in detail. You will be taught how to build your first application with ASP.NET Core from scratch.

  • The best thing about this course is its focus on explaining how to work with a database to display and edit data. You will explore middleware and view components with the entity framework as well.
  • This course is for those who wish to gain skills and knowledge of Asp.NET Core required to become productive in a typical business-oriented application.

Coursera Plus Courses

save

Learning ASP.NET Core MVC

      • Jess Chadwick via LinkedIn Learning
      • 65,098+ already enrolled!
      • ★★★★★ (662 Ratings)

Learning ASP.NET Core MVC

Online Course Effectiveness Score 
Content Engagement Practice Career Benefit
Excellent
★★★★★
Good
★★★★☆
Fair
★★★☆☆
Fair
★★★☆☆

In this intermediate-level course, you will understand the basics of ASP.NET Core in detail. The instructor will explain how you can create your own professional quality applications.

  • The reason why we chose this course is its focus on explaining how to work with the ASP.NET Core framework. You will understand the different techniques required to manage data and reuse code.
  • This course is for those who wish to learn to construct web APIs and understand how to secure new applications in detail.
This course turned out to be perfect for those who wish to learn ASP.NET Core in detail. The course can be of great help for all the job seekers and those preparing for job interview. (Vijayaraj S, ★★★★★)

save

Complete Guide to Building an App with .Net Core and React

      • Neil Cummings via Udemy
      • 31,187+ already enrolled!
      • ★★★★★ (5,447 Ratings)

Complete guide to building an app with .Net Core and React

Online Course Effectiveness Score 
Content Engagement Practice Career Benefit
Excellent
★★★★★
Excellent
★★★★★
Fair
★★★☆☆
Fair
★★★☆☆

This course offers a complete guide to build an app from start to end and that too using ASP.NET Core, React, and Mobx.

  • The best thing about this course is its focus on explaining how to build a Web API in .Net Core with clean architecture using the CQRS+ Mediator pattern.
  • This course is for those who wish to learn to build a multi-project solution with .Net Core.

Related: How Long Does it take to Learn React?

This was an in-depth course that has so much to offer. It was my first time seeing React and type script and can say it was fun to listen to. I have definitely learned so much from this course. (Jacob S, ★★★★★)

save

Build a Wishlist Application with ASP.NET Core

      • Eric Fisher via Pluralsight
      • 02h 30m of effort required!
      • ★★★★☆ (650 Ratings)

Build a Wishlist Application with ASP.NET Core

Online Course Effectiveness Score 
Content Engagement Practice Career Benefit
Good
★★★★☆
Good
★★★★☆
Fair
★★★☆☆
Fair
★★★☆☆

This course will help you understand how to create an ASP.NET Core wishlist application from the comfort of your home.

  • The reason why we chose this course is its focus on explaining how to add middleware/configuration to startups.cs and create home views and home controllers.
  • This course is for those who wish to understand how to create item views, item controllers, and so much more using ASP.NET.

save

Complete guide to ASP.NET Core MVC (.NET 6)

      • Bhrugen Patel via Udemy
      • 38,550+ already enrolled!
      • ★★★★☆ (7,584 Ratings)

Complete guide to ASP.NET Core MVC (.NET 6)

Online Course Effectiveness Score 
Content Engagement Practice Career Benefit
Excellent
★★★★★
Excellent
★★★★★
Fair
★★★☆☆
Fair
★★★☆☆

If you are interested in learning to build a real-world application using ASP.NET Core MVC, Entity Framework Core, and ASP.NET Core Identity then this course is for you.

  • The reason why we chose this course is its focus on explaining how to integrate identity framework and add more fields to users. You will get to build 2 projects throughout the course.
  • This course is for those who wish to learn the basic fundamentals of ASP.NET MVC Core in detail.
This was an excellent course that has so much to offer about ASP.NET Core, product management, user management, shopping cart processing and so much more. (Martin D, ★★★★★)
Learn Most In-demand Skills

continue with more Best + Free ASP.NET Courses…

save

Complete SignalR On ASP.NET Core

      • Fiodar Sazanavets via tutorialspoint
      • 01 Hour of effort required!

This course explains how you can enable two-way real-time communication between the client and the server on ASP.NET Core.

  • The best thing about this course is its focus on explaining how to transport mechanism and set up your environment.
  • This course is for those who wish to understand all about SignalR and Security in ASP.NET Core.

save

ASP.NET Core: Security

      • Ervis Trupja via LinkedIn Learning
      • 7,560+ already enrolled!
      • ★★★★★ (71 Ratings)

ASP.NET Core - Security

Online Course Effectiveness Score 
Content Engagement Practice Career Benefit
Excellent
★★★★★
Good
★★★★☆
Fair
★★★☆☆
Fair
★★★☆☆

This is an intermediate-level course where you will explore the techniques for securing and controlling access to your ASP.NET Core applications.

  • The best thing about this course is its focus on explaining some of the most common attacks that can occur and how you can protect against them.
  • This course is for those who wish to learn to protect sensitive data in their applications using data protection API.

Related: Best + Free Comptia Security+ Training Courses with Certificates

This course offers very good delivery of topics and one can easily learn so much about how to secure access to your ASP.NET Core applications. (Shailamole P, ★★★★★)

save

Build an app with ASPNET Core and Angular from scratch

      • Neil Cummings via Udemy
      • 84,964+ already enrolled!
      • ★★★★★ (19,302 Ratings)

Build an app with ASPNET Core and Angular from scratch

Online Course Effectiveness Score 
Content Engagement Practice Career Benefit
Excellent
★★★★★
Excellent
★★★★★
Fair
★★★☆☆
Fair
★★★☆☆

In this class, you will be taught how to build a web application from start to end using ASP.NET Core, Entity Framework Core, and Angular V6.

  • The reason why we chose this class is its focus on explaining how to structure an Angular application using best practices.
  • This class is for those who wish to gain a practical understanding of Angular and ASP.NET Core.
This is truly an amazing class and I am glad to have enrolled in it. This class has definitely accelerated by learning of Angular and .NET. It has answered so many questions that I had in my mind. (Wee Shanming, ★★★★★)

save

Creating GraphQL APIs With ASP.Net Core For Beginners

      • Nilay Mehta via tutorialspoint
      • 03 Hours of effort required!

If you are interested in understanding the GraphQL specifications along with the use of the GraphQL dotnet library for creating GraphQL API & Client then this course is for you.

  • The reason why we chose this course is its focus on explaining the advanced GraphQL concepts and how you can create your own GraphQL APIs.
  • This course is for those who wish to understand all about creating GraphQL APIs with ASP.NET Core.

save

ASP.NET Core: Middleware

      • Jeff Fritz via LinkedIn Learning
      • 23,182+ already enrolled!
      • ★★★★★ (72 Ratings)
Online Course Effectiveness Score 
Content Engagement Practice Career Benefit
Excellent
★★★★★
Excellent
★★★★★
Fair
★★★☆☆
Fair
★★★☆☆

This intermediate-level tutorial talks about what Middleware is and how you can write Middleware components on your own to enhance ASP.NET Core web applications.

  • The best thing about this tutorial is its focus on explaining all about the inline and external implementation along with condition mapping.
  • This tutorial is for those who wish to learn different techniques for adjusting the order in which Middleware is called and many other things about Middleware in detail.
I would like to thank the instructor for this amazing tutorial for ASP.NET Middleware. The explanations were great, relevant and to-the-point. (Ahmed Halim, ★★★★★)

save

Create a StarChart Web API using ASP.NET Core

      • Eric Fisher via Pluralsight
      • 02h 45m of effort required!
      • ★★★★★ (504 Ratings)

In this project, you will learn to use ASP.NET Core with C# to implement a Web API for tracking celestial objects.

  • The reason why we chose this project is its focus on explaining how to create a Celestial object model and then a Celestial Object Controller Class.
  • This project is for those who wish to understand how to implement a Web API for tracking celestial objects.

save

Deploying ASP.NET Core Applications

      • Nate Barbettini via LinkedIn Learning
      • 12,441+ already enrolled!
      • ★★★★★ (55 Ratings)

Deploying ASP.NET Core Applications

Online Course Effectiveness Score 
Content Engagement Practice Career Benefit
Good
★★★★☆
Good
★★★★☆
Fair
★★★☆☆
Fair
★★★☆☆

This is an intermediate-level course that explains how to deploy cross-platform ASP.NET Core applications in detail.

  • The best thing about this course is its focus on explaining how to deploy ASP.NET apps to IIS and cloud services like Azure, Linux servers, and Docker containers.
  • This course is for those who wish to get practical tips on each deployment option and understand how Docker Hub can make it easier to distribute your images across machines.
The course is not bad but I was not able to get a certificate of completion I wonder why. (Marc Noon, ★★★☆☆)

Programming Courses
100+ Courses
★★★★★

Cybersecurity courses
30+ Courses
★★★★★

Business Courses
70+ Courses
★★★★☆

Blockchain Courses
20+ Courses
★★★★★

Data Science Courses
150+ Courses
★★★★★

Mobile App Development Courses
50+ Courses
★★★★★